novelo's recommendation
"Anyone can send a bouquet - this is the uncommon way to send flowers. A nutrient-rich gel supplies all that this orchid needs to grow in its sterilized test tube. No water or maintenance necessary - biotechnology does the work for you. When the plant reaches the top of the tube simply transfer to potting soil"

I bought one at Monteverde Costa Rica for 8 dollars. They are all over the place here, charging 30-40$ per orchid is STUPID.
The process of growing orchids like this probably costs them all of 20 cents. You whack a piece of leaf off, cut that leaf into as many tiny pieces as you can, and put it on petri dish gel with some nutrients. This is the same way most of our African violets are grown in the US. It literally costs them pennies.
